Transaction 264e17f588250aab9257f3f90bb71d899fa083f92bcd6d5cf58a50b62b0a5b5e
1 Input
1 Output
-
264e17f588250aab9257f3f90bb71d899fa083f92bcd6d5cf58a50b62b0a5b5e:0
- value
- 623644
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e19f60d561a4e30dd7d8be84fedced1b4fa0e32
- address
- bc1qlcvlvr2krf8rphta305ylmww6x605r3j3dumf5